介绍
nezha-cli
是一款基于Node.js
的命令行工具,用于加速前端开发的流程。通过nezha-cli
,我们可以快速创建React、Angular、Vue等各类型的项目模板,同时也可以很方便地进行代码编译、打包、测试、发布等常用操作。
安装
在开始使用nezha-cli
之前,需要先安装Node.js
和npm
。如果已经安装过npm
,可以通过以下命令来全局安装nezha-cli
:
npm install -g nezha-cli
安装完成后,可以输入以下命令检查是否安装成功:
nezha -v
如果输出版本号,则表明已经安装成功。
使用
项目生成
在开始创建项目之前,需要先了解下nezha-cli
内置的模板类型,可以通过以下命令查看:
nezha ls
输出类似于以下信息:
react vue angular lit ...
可以按照以下命令来创建对应类型的项目:
nezha create react my-react-project
其中,react
是项目类型,my-react-project
是项目名,可以根据需要进行修改。
代码编译
在进入项目之前,需要进入到创建好的项目根目录下。假设我们已经进入my-react-project
项目的根目录,可以按以下命令来编译代码:
npm run build
如果需要进行开发实时预览,则可以按以下命令:
npm run dev
测试
使用nezha-cli
可以很方便地进行项目测试。在my-react-project
项目的根目录下,可以按以下命令进行测试:
npm run test
代码发布
代码发布是项目最后一步,需要注意代码质量,以及发布的版本号。在项目根目录下,可以按以下命令进行发布:
npm run publish
例子
我们来看一个简单的例子,创建一个Vue项目,并进行实时预览:
-- -------------------- ---- ------- - ------------- --- ------- -- --------- - ------ ----- -- - ------- ----- ------ --- -------------- - ------ -- -------------- - ---- --- ------- - ------ --- --- ---
在浏览器中输入localhost:8080
地址,即可看到预览页面。
总结
通过这篇文章,我们了解了nezha-cli
的安装和使用方法,并通过例子来学习了如何快速创建一个Vue项目并进行实时预览。在实际开发中,nezha-cli
可以帮助我们提升开发效率,避免重复的工作。希望本文能对读者有所帮助。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6005544181e8991b448d192e